Okay, let's be honest, who hasn't felt the urge to ditch modern life and just...chill? That's where "Reject Humanity, Return To Monke" comes in. It's become a fun, internet-fueled escape from the stresses of work, bills, and endless social media scrolling. It's a lighthearted way to express a longing for simplicity, a connection with nature, and a break from the often-absurd complexities of being a human in the 21st century. While nobody is actually suggesting we evolve backwards, the sentiment resonates because it taps into a universal desire for a less complicated existence.

But what does it really mean, and how can different people interpret it? For beginners, it's simply a meme, a funny catchphrase. They might share a picture of a monkey doing something relatable or use it as a reaction to something frustrating. There's no deeper meaning required! It's just a bit of online silliness to lighten the mood. The benefit? A quick laugh and a sense of community with others who "get it."

For families, "Return To Monke" can be a starting point for conversations about nature and animal behavior. It can spark an interest in learning about primates, their habitats, and the importance of conservation. Instead of just seeing it as a meme, turn it into an educational opportunity. Watch nature documentaries together, visit a zoo (responsibly!), or even just spend more time outdoors. The benefit here is fostering a love for nature and creating shared experiences.

For hobbyists, especially those interested in minimalism, mindfulness, or prehistory, "Reject Humanity, Return To Monke" can represent a deeper philosophical reflection. It's about questioning societal norms, embracing simplicity, and connecting with our primal instincts. Think about the essence of what it means to be "monke" – free from societal pressures, living in the present moment, and prioritizing basic needs. Variations could include embracing a more minimalist lifestyle, spending time in nature without technology, or focusing on activities that bring genuine joy.

So, how can you get started? It's easier than you think! Here are a few simple, practical tips:

  • Unplug for an hour each day: Put down your phone, turn off the TV, and just be present.
  • Spend time in nature: Go for a walk in the woods, sit by a river, or simply lie on the grass and look at the sky.
  • Embrace simplicity: Declutter your home, simplify your schedule, and focus on what truly matters.
  • Do something that makes you happy: Whether it's dancing, singing, drawing, or playing a game, make time for activities that bring you joy.
  • Share a silly meme with a friend: Keep the humor alive!

Ultimately, "Reject Humanity, Return To Monke" is about finding a balance. It's not about literally abandoning civilization, but about finding ways to disconnect from the pressures of modern life and reconnect with what truly matters. It's about finding joy in the simple things, embracing our primal instincts, and remembering that it's okay to be a little bit silly sometimes.
